What Makes Content Go Viral in 2026?
Before diving into the tactics, it’s important to understand the key elements that make content go viral in 2026. While there’s no guaranteed formula, viral content often shares these characteristics:
1. Emotional Resonance
Content that evokes strong emotions—whether joy, surprise, anger, or inspiration—tends to perform better. In 2026, audiences crave authenticity and relatability. Emotional storytelling is a powerful tool to connect with your audience on a deeper level.
2. Shareability
Viral content is easy to share across platforms. This means creating content that is not only engaging but also optimized for social media. Think about how your audience will interact with your content—will they want to share it with friends, comment on it, or save it for later?
3. Timeliness and Relevance
Trends move fast in 2026. Content that taps into current events, pop culture, or trending topics has a higher chance of going viral. Staying updated with the latest trends and incorporating them into your content strategy is crucial.
4. High-Quality Media
Visuals and multimedia play a significant role in viral content. High-quality images, videos, infographics, and interactive elements can make your content more engaging and shareable. In 2026, platforms like TikTok, Instagram Reels, and YouTube Shorts continue to dominate, emphasizing the importance of visual storytelling.
5. Value and Utility
Content that provides real value—whether through education, entertainment, or problem-solving—is more likely to be shared. In 2026, audiences appreciate content that helps them learn something new, solve a problem, or improve their lives in some way.

Step 1: Know Your Audience
The first step in creating viral content is understanding your target audience. Who are they? What are their interests, pain points, and preferences? Use tools like Google Analytics, social media insights, and surveys to gather data about your audience.
In 2026, personalization is key. Tailor your content to resonate with your audience’s specific needs and desires. The more you know about your audience, the better you can craft content that speaks directly to them.
Step 2: Research Trends and Topics
Staying ahead of trends is essential for creating viral content. Use tools like Google Trends, BuzzSumo, and social media platforms to identify trending topics in your niche. Step 3: Craft a Compelling Headline
Your headline is the first thing people see, and it can make or break your content’s success. A great headline should be attention-grabbing, clear, and evoke curiosity. Use power words, numbers, and emotional triggers to make your headline stand out.
For example:
- “10 Viral Content Tips You Need to Try in 2026”
- “How I Got 1 Million Views in 24 Hours: A Viral Content Case Study”
- “The Ultimate Guide to Creating Viral Content in 2026”
Step 4: Create High-Quality, Engaging Content
Once you have your topic and headline, it’s time to create the content. Focus on delivering value through well-researched, informative, and engaging copy. Use a mix of text, images, videos, and interactive elements to keep your audience engaged.
In 2026, short-form video content continues to dominate. Consider incorporating video into your blog posts or social media strategy to increase engagement. Tools like Canva, Adobe Spark, and InVideo can help you create professional-looking visuals and videos.
Step 5: Optimize for SEO
Search engine optimization (SEO) is crucial for increasing your content’s visibility. Use relevant keywords naturally throughout your content, optimize your meta descriptions, and ensure your content is mobile-friendly. Step 6: Promote Your Content
Creating great content is only half the battle—you also need to promote it effectively. Share your content across all your social media platforms, engage with your audience, and consider running paid ads to boost visibility. Collaborate with influencers or other content creators in your niche to expand your reach.
In 2026, email marketing remains a powerful tool for content promotion. Build an email list and send regular newsletters featuring your latest content. Tools like Mailchimp and ConvertKit can help you automate this process.
Step 7: Engage with Your Audience
Engagement is key to virality. Respond to comments, encourage discussions, and create a community around your content. The more your audience interacts with your content, the more likely it is to be shared and go viral.
In 2026, interactive content like polls, quizzes, and live streams are highly effective for boosting engagement. Use these formats to keep your audience involved and invested in your content.
Step 8: Analyze and Iterate
Finally, track your content’s performance using analytics tools. Monitor metrics like views, shares, comments, and conversion rates. Use this data to refine your strategy and create even better content in the future.

Common Mistakes to Avoid
While creating viral content is exciting, it’s easy to make mistakes that can hinder your success. Here are some common pitfalls to avoid in 2026:
1. Ignoring Your Audience
Creating content without understanding your audience’s needs and preferences is a recipe for failure. Always prioritize your audience and tailor your content to resonate with them.
2. Overlooking SEO
SEO is crucial for increasing your content’s visibility. Neglecting SEO best practices can result in your content getting lost in the vast sea of online information.
3. Focusing Too Much on Trends
While trends are important, don’t sacrifice your brand’s authenticity for the sake of chasing them. Stay true to your voice and values while incorporating trends in a meaningful way.
4. Neglecting Engagement
Engagement is key to virality. Failing to interact with your audience can limit your content’s reach and impact. Always respond to comments, encourage discussions, and build a community around your content.
5. Not Analyzing Performance
Data is your best friend when it comes to creating viral content. Failing to track and analyze your content’s performance can prevent you from making informed decisions and improving your strategy.
